The celestial sphere is an imaginary sphere of gigantic radius with the earth located at its center.

Celestial sphere

The poles of the celestial sphere are aligned with the poles of the Earth. Celestial sphere: Celestial sphere, the apparent surface of the heavens, on which the stars seem to be fixed.

For the purpose of establishing coordinate systems to mark the positions of heavenly bodies, it can be considered a real sphere at an infinite distance from the Earth. The Earth’s axis, extended to infinity. A celestial sphere can also refer to a physical model of the celestial sphere or celestial globe.

Such globes map the constellations on the outside of a sphere, resulting in a mirror image of the constellations as seen from Earth. The oldest surviving example of such an artifact is the globe of the Farnese Atlas sculpture, a 2nd-century copy of an older (Hellenistic period, ca.
